Minutes — Management Meeting

Prepared for the incoming director. Topic: possible acquisition of Greyfen Analytics. Due diligence 70% complete. Valuation gap remains; Greyfen seeks a premium. Integration risks flagged by Ops. Decision deferred to next month. Talla Nyberg leads negotiations. Our walk-away position is stated below.

board note of fawig-kagup: Only 48 of the 435 pilot accounts renewed Rusion, so a churn review is set for September 12. Fenwynox Logistics is in early talks to buy Sorielek Systems for about $117.8 million.

Runbook bit: Timora timetable solver, constraint regression checks

Before approving solver changes, run the Brackenford High fixture set — it's the nastiest one, with double-booked gyms and part-time staff. Watch for the solver "succeeding" by dropping soft constraints; diff the penalty report against baseline, not just the pass/fail flag. If room clashes appear, the conflict matrix probably got reordered — reject and ask for a rebase. The baseline was generated from the build token below.

trace token, kahog-tajeg: htk6_97d963

Q3 Planning Note — Gross-Margin Review

Branch managers should note that the Harlowe Mills gross-margin review concluded last week. Margins on the Cindervale appliance range slipped 1.8 points, largely due to freight surcharges on the Nordquay route. Finance has modelled three corrective scenarios, and each branch will receive a tailored target sheet by month-end. Please verify your stock valuation figures before submitting commentary, as discrepancies delay consolidation. The following summary is confidential and covers the agreed plan.

internal memo for fajog-yagaf: Gross margin on Ulaael came in at 20 percent against a plan of 10 percent. Only 9 of the 80 pilot accounts renewed Ulaael, so a churn review is set for July 1.

## Sensor drift: what to do at 3am

If the GrowLoop controller starts reporting humidity swings that don't match the backup probes in the Fernwick greenhouse, it's almost always sensor drift, not an actual climate event. Don't panic and don't touch the vents manually. First, restart the calibration daemon and give it ten minutes to re-baseline. If readings still disagree by more than 5%, flip the controller into safe mode. The safe-mode thresholds it will use are these.

config for yahap-bajof:
[istix]
host = istix.qorvelsys.internal
user = istix_svc
database = istix_prod